Tire testing & model parameterization to fit vehicle dynamic simulation requirements

Tire models for vehicle dynamics must meet the highest demands regarding model accuracy and predictive analytics. The variety of system targets, platforms, tools, and maneuver tests makes it extremely complex for OEMs to define unified re-usable tire models. As a result, multiple test and parameterization processes often run in parallel for different applications.

In this webinar, we present a methodology that combines multi-domain applications within one single tire model and unified parameterization. The Simcenter solution delivers models that are fit-for-purpose and ensures an optimal balance between accuracy and cost.

In cooperation with leading passenger car OEMs, we demonstrate 4 application examples of the tire testing and parameterization method:

  • ABS braking – to cost-efficiently identify the tire transient response
  • Low-friction ESC controller tuning – to perform accurate low-friction tire tests
  • Extreme handling – to define the optimal balance between model accuracy level and the number of tire tests under combined slip conditions
  • Parking – to extend a regular tire model for low-speed maneuvering
